Studio 8

Studio 8

Nill

Nill

Official website Nill

Telephone Nill

Address 2833 E Interstate 20, Odessa, TX 79766, United States

Nation US

Province Texas

City Odessa

County Nill

Street 2833 E Interstate 20

Zip code 79766

Plus VM2H+VP Odessa, Texas, USA

Longitude -102.32073349999999 Latitude 31.8521282

Review
Review

★★★☆☆

1 review

User

James Butler

Nill

Overall the hotel was quiet, I couldn't hear my neighbors. The room was clean with no bed bugs, dirty counters, or trash under the furniture. My only real complaint was the hotel was hot in the hallways and the A/C in the room only seemed to work half the time. The room wasn't hot but definitely wasn't cool either. Also the vending machine was broken so no pop or water unless you brought some with you. Was livable for a single night but the place needs some maintenance.

a year ago

Our Amenities

Check-in time:15:00

Check-out time:12:00

/

Nill

/

Nill

/

Nill

Other Hotels
Travelodge by Wyndham Odessa
Deluxe Inn Odessa
Hampton Inn by Hilton Odessa
Baymont by Wyndham Odessa
Westerner Motel